pki-tomcatd service fails to start on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7.5
Issue
- When attempting to start IPA services,
pki-tomcatdis failing to start
# ipactl start
Existing service file detected!
Assuming stale, cleaning and proceeding
Starting Directory Service
Starting krb5kdc Service
Starting kadmin Service
Starting named Service
Starting httpd Service
Starting ipa-custodia Service
Starting ntpd Service
Starting pki-tomcatd Service
Failed to start pki-tomcatd Service
Shutting down
Hint: You can use --ignore-service-failure option for forced start in case that a non-critical service failed
Aborting ipactl
Environment
-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7.5 (RHEL 7.5)
- ipa-server-4.5.4-10.el7_5.3
